Under California law, child custody is decided by the court based on the best interests of the child. The ‘best interests of the child's standard is a national set of laws that govern child custody throughout the country.
Child custody can be physical or legal. Physical custody refers to the location where the child would reside. This could be either shared by both parents or exclusively held by one. Legal custody is the decision-making authority of parents on important issues like education, healthcare, religion, etc.
Broadly, there are two kinds of custody - legal custody and physical custody. Both are further divided into sole or shared legal custody and sole or joint physical custody.
Under joint physical custody, the child lives with both parents for a specified amount of time.
The child resides with one parent exclusively and gets visitations from the other.
Joint legal custody refers to the rights of both parents to decide on important matters of their child's life (education, healthcare, religious upbringing, etc.)
Sole legal custody is when the child's care and upbringing are left to one parent exclusively. This is a rare arrangement only awarded if one parent is deemed unfit for parenting.
California courts view joint or shared custody arrangements as the most beneficial for the children. In the absence of any history of domestic violence or substance abuse, the court would want a shared agreement between the parents for their child's custody.

The courts take several aspects into consideration when determining child custody in Cypress. These factors may include the child's age & gender, the parent's ability to provide a stable & nurturing environment, the child's relationship with each parent, any history of domestic violence/substance abuse, & the child's preference (if they are of a certain age & maturity level).
Yes, grandparents in Cypress can file for custody of their grandchildren under certain circumstances. The court may give custody to grandparents if it's in the kid's best interest & one or both parents are unfit or unable to care for the youngster.
To modify an existing child custody order in Cypress, you must demonstrate a significant change in circumstances since the original order was put in place. This change could include factors such as a parent's relocation, a parent's remarriage or new relationship, a parent's substance abuse issues, or a parent's inability to provide a safe & stable environment for the child.
Yes, you can request supervised visitation in Cypress if you believe it is necessary to protect the well-being & safety of your child. This request is commonly made when there are worries about the other parent's care or domestic violence/substance abuse issues. The court will consider the circumstances & evidence presented to determine whether supervised visitation is warranted. Child custody plays a significant role in determining child support obligations in Cypress. The parent in O.C. with primary physical custody of the child typically receives child support payments from the noncustodial parent.
